Check the published version number against the current version on your TV (found under Settings > System > About ). If the web version is newer, download the .zip file.

: You can often see your current software version by entering 1 2 3 6 5 4 on your remote while watching TV.

Server traffic or local network fluctuations can cause over-the-air updates to fail. Restart your internet router, power cycle your TV by unplugging it for two minutes, and attempt the update again. If it continues to fail, switch to the manual USB method.

| Update Method | ⚡ Network Update (Easiest) | 💾 USB Update (Most Reliable) |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Downloads & installs directly from TV settings | Downloads file to computer, transfers to USB, then updates TV | | Requires | A stable internet connection | Computer, stable internet, USB flash drive | | Ease of Use | Very simple, fully automatic | More steps, requires manual setup | | When to Use | Recommended for general maintenance | Ideal when Wi-Fi is slow or for large/challenging updates |
